PRECAUTIONS
TO AVOID POSSIBLE EXPOSURE
TO EXCESSIVE MICROWAVE ENERGY ...
fLDo not attempt to operate this oven with the door open, since open-door operation can result in
harmful exposure to microwave energy. It is important not to defeat or tamper with the safety
interlock.
.fLDo not operate the oven if it is damaged. It is particularly importantthat the oven door close
properly and that there is no damage to the:
- door (bent)
- hinges and latches (broken or loosened)
- door seals and sealing surfaces.
;fLDo not place any object between the oven front face and the door, or allow soil or cleaner
residue to accumulate on sealing surfaces.
:L_'he oven should not be adjusted or repaired by anyone except properly qualified service
personnel.
GROUNDING INSTRUCTIONS
This appliance
must be grounded!
If an electrical
short circuit occurs, grounding
reduces the risk of electric
shock by providing
an escape wire for the electric current. This appliance
is equipped with a cord having a
grounding
wire with a grounding
plug.
Put the plug into an outlet that is properly
installed end grounded.
WARNING
If you use the grounding plug improperly, you risk electric shock.
Ask a qualified
electrician
or the Sears Service
Department
if you do not understand
the grounding
instructions
or if you wonder whether
the appliance
is
properly
grounded.
This appliance
has a short power supply cord to
reduce the risk of anyone's
tripping over or becoming
entangled
in the cord. You may use an extension
cord if you are careful.
If you use an extension cord, be sure that:
Three-Pronged
(Grounding)
Plug
fu the extension
cord has the same electrical
rating
as the appliance.
fu the marked
rating of the extension
cord shall be
equal to or greater than the electrical
rating of the
appliance.
.fu the extension
cord is a grounding-type
3-wire
cord.
fu the extension
cord does not drape over a
countertop
or tabletop,
where it can be pulled on
by children
or tripped
over accidentally.
fu the electrical
cord is dry and not pinched
or
crushed
in any way.
NOTE: This oven draws 13 amperes
at on 120 Volts, 60 Hz.
